[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[Qemu-devel] [RFC V2 5/7] qcow2: Add qcow2_dedup_control.
From: |
Eric Blake |
Subject: |
Re: [Qemu-devel] [RFC V2 5/7] qcow2: Add qcow2_dedup_control. |
Date: |
Thu, 07 Feb 2013 09:06:06 -0700 |
User-agent: |
Mozilla/5.0 (X11; Linux x86_64; rv:17.0) Gecko/20130110 Thunderbird/17.0.2 |
On 02/06/2013 05:32 AM, Benoît Canet wrote:
> ---
> block/qcow2-dedup.c | 31 +++++++++++++++++++++++++++++++
> block/qcow2.c | 2 ++
> block/qcow2.h | 1 +
> 3 files changed, 34 insertions(+)
>
> diff --git a/block/qcow2-dedup.c b/block/qcow2-dedup.c
> index bbbb1ac..66fb415 100644
> --- a/block/qcow2-dedup.c
> +++ b/block/qcow2-dedup.c
> @@ -1278,15 +1278,20 @@ static void
> qcow2_deduplicate_after_resuming(BlockDriverState *bs)
> BDRVQcowState *s = bs->opaque;
> uint64_t i;
> bool processed;
> + bool exit;
Naming local variables that shadow global functions is risky. I don't
know if qemu has a policy on being clean under -Wshadow, but this would
fail such a policy.
--
Eric Blake eblake redhat com +1-919-301-3266
Libvirt virtualization library http://libvirt.org
signature.asc
Description: OpenPGP digital signature
- [Qemu-devel] [RFC V2 0/7] QCOW2 asynchronous deduplication, Benoît Canet, 2013/02/06
- [Qemu-devel] [RFC V2 2/7] qcow2: Add code to deduplicate cluster flagged with QCOW_OFLAG_TO_DEDUP., Benoît Canet, 2013/02/06
- [Qemu-devel] [RFC V2 6/7] qcow2: Make dedup status persists., Benoît Canet, 2013/02/06
- [Qemu-devel] [RFC V2 5/7] qcow2: Add qcow2_dedup_control., Benoît Canet, 2013/02/06
- Re: [Qemu-devel] [RFC V2 5/7] qcow2: Add qcow2_dedup_control.,
Eric Blake <=
- [Qemu-devel] [RFC V2 7/7] qmp: Add block-dedup-control., Benoît Canet, 2013/02/06
- [Qemu-devel] [RFC V2 4/7] block: Add bdrv_dedup_control to start and stop deduplication., Benoît Canet, 2013/02/06
- [Qemu-devel] [RFC V2 3/7] block: Add bdrv_has_dedup., Benoît Canet, 2013/02/06
- [Qemu-devel] [RFC V2 1/7] block: Add BlockDriver function prototype to pause and resume deduplication., Benoît Canet, 2013/02/06